Description:
Because suicide is a painful and provocative topic, advanced assessment skills are essential (Sommers-Flanagan & Sommers-Flanagan, 2021). For many reasons, as Sommers-Flanagan and Sommers-Flanagan explained, professionals sometimes engage poorly with clients who are suicidal. This Continuing Professional Development presents the 11 components of a comprehensive suicide assessment process.
Learning Objectives:
1.Know and monitor for the individualized presence or absence of suicide risk factors, protective factors, and warning signs while developing a therapeutic relationship.
2.Apply therapeutic assessment to explore suicidal ideation, strengths, suicide plans, and previous attempts.
3.Understand how to engage in collaborative problem-solving and safety planning for assessment, treatment, and decision-making purposes.
